Bossa, Ssenkaaba React To Express Win Against Villa
Share on FacebookShare on Twitter

Forward George Ssenkaba’s strike earned Express FC a 1 – 0 win over arch rivals S.C Villa on Saturday at the Muteesa II stadium Wankulukuku during matchday five of the 2020/21 Uganda Premier League (UPL) season.

After both teams fired blanks in the first half, Ssenkaaba cooly and calmly slotted home from the left wing leaving shot stopper Saidi Keni helpless immediately after restart.

The game saw both teams cancel each other out in either half with few chances to write home about. Forward Eric Kambale rattled the cross bar 18 minutes into the game while Kabonge Nicolas sent his freekick off mark just outside the 18 yard area.

After recess, only Ssenkaaba’s goal made the difference and Express Head coach Wasswa Bossa says the most important thing was earning a victory in the derby.

“The most important thing is that we earned all the three points in the derby. Our target remains trying to win silverware, this is now done, we look forward to the next games next year,” Bossa told the club website.

Goal scorer George Ssenkaaba emphasized that the team learnt from their mistakes in the past game (Vs Mbarara City).

“When we came back from Mbarara, we decided to iron out our mistakes, it wasn’t an easy game but I’m happy we picked up a win, it’s not all over, we shall go back and plan for the remaining games,”  Ssenkasba said.

The win takes Express FC to 8 points after four games. The league will resume in February 2021 after CHAN.
